  • Post-Graduation Work Permits: The Post-Graduation Work Permit (PGWP) program remains a key software for retaining worldwide graduates. The eligibility standards and period of work permits have been adjusted to offer higher flexibility and support for graduates.
  • Canadian Experience Class: International college students who gain Canadian work experience by way of the PGWP may be eligible for the Canadian Experience Class, which offers a pathway to everlasting residency.

A Canadian immigration on-line assessment is a tool designed to gauge your qualifications and suitability for Canadian immigration programs. It sometimes entails answering a collection of questions associated to your private, educational, and skilled background. The assessment helps identify which immigration pathways might be out there to you based in your specific circumstances.
